A Graduate Certificate in Machine Learning for Livestock Genetics provides specialized training in applying cutting-edge machine learning techniques to improve animal breeding and genetic selection. The program equips students with the skills to analyze complex genomic data, predict animal performance, and optimize breeding strategies for enhanced efficiency and sustainability in the livestock industry.
Learning outcomes typically include mastering statistical modeling, data mining, and predictive analytics relevant to livestock genetics. Students gain proficiency in programming languages like R and Python, crucial for implementing machine learning algorithms. The curriculum often covers topics such as genomic selection, quantitative genetics, and bioinformatics, all essential components of modern livestock improvement.
The duration of a Graduate Certificate in Machine Learning for Livestock Genetics varies depending on the institution, but generally ranges from several months to a year of part-time or full-time study. The intensive nature of the program allows for focused learning and rapid skill development.
This certificate holds significant industry relevance, addressing the growing demand for data scientists and analysts skilled in applying machine learning to agricultural challenges. Graduates are well-positioned for careers in animal breeding companies, research institutions, and agricultural technology firms. The program offers a competitive edge in a rapidly evolving field, enabling graduates to contribute to advancements in precision livestock farming and sustainable agriculture.
The combination of machine learning expertise and a deep understanding of livestock genetics makes graduates highly sought after. This interdisciplinary approach addresses crucial issues such as improving animal health, enhancing feed efficiency, and promoting sustainable livestock production, thereby contributing to global food security.
